Understanding Portable AC Technology
Portable air conditioners work on the same basic principles as window units, but with the added convenience of portability. They use a refrigeration cycle to cool the air:
- Heat Absorption: The unit draws in warm air from the room.
- Refrigerant Cooling: This warm air passes over a refrigerant, a special fluid that absorbs heat and changes from a liquid to a gas.
- Heat Release: The now-hot refrigerant is then pumped outside, usually through an exhaust hose. This is crucial – the heat isn't simply disappearing; it's being moved outside the space you're cooling.
- Cool Air Circulation: The cooled refrigerant returns to its liquid state, releasing the absorbed heat, and the now-cooled air is blown back into the room.
The key difference between portable and window units lies in the exhaust. Window units exhaust the hot air directly outside through a vent built into the unit itself. Portable units require a flexible hose that needs to be vented through a window, door, or other opening. This necessitates a proper seal to prevent hot air from being drawn back inside.
Types of Small Portable Air Conditioners
While the basic technology remains consistent, several variations exist in the market:
-
Evaporative Coolers (Swamp Coolers): These are generally cheaper and use less energy. However, they only work effectively in dry climates and add humidity to the air. They don't use refrigerant, instead utilizing water evaporation to cool the air. They are not true air conditioners and are best for dry, hot climates.
-
Refrigerated Air Conditioners: These use the refrigeration cycle described above, providing significantly more cooling power, especially in humid environments. They are more expensive and consume more energy. This is the type most people think of when they hear "portable air conditioner."
-
Single Hose vs. Dual Hose: Single-hose units exhaust hot air and draw in fresh air through the same hose. This means they might slightly reduce the air pressure in the room. Dual-hose units have separate hoses for exhaust and intake, leading to better cooling efficiency and air quality.
-
Dehumidification Feature: Many portable AC units incorporate a dehumidification function, removing excess moisture from the air and improving comfort levels, especially in humid climates.
Key Features to Consider When Choosing a Portable AC Unit
Choosing the right portable AC can feel overwhelming, but focusing on these key features will help you narrow your search:
-
BTU (British Thermal Units): This rating indicates the cooling capacity of the unit. Higher BTU means more cooling power. Consider the size of the room you intend to cool – larger rooms require higher BTU ratings. A good rule of thumb is to calculate the square footage of your room and consult BTU guidelines from manufacturers.
-
Energy Efficiency (EER or SEER): The Energy Efficiency Ratio (EER) or Seasonal Energy Efficiency Ratio (SEER) measures how efficiently the unit converts energy into cooling. Higher EER/SEER ratings mean lower energy bills.
-
Noise Level: Portable AC units can be noisy. Check the decibel (dB) rating. Lower dB ratings indicate quieter operation.
-
Size and Weight: Consider the portability aspect. How easy will it be to move the unit from room to room? Measure doorways and hallways to ensure easy transport.
-
Features: Look for features like programmable timers, remote controls, multiple fan speeds, and sleep modes for enhanced convenience and comfort.
Choosing the Right BTU for Your Space
Selecting the appropriate BTU is critical for effective cooling. Underpowering a room will result in inadequate cooling, while overpowering it is wasteful and might lead to cycling on and off constantly. Use the following guidelines as a starting point:
- Small Room (under 150 sq ft): 5,000-7,000 BTU
- Medium Room (150-300 sq ft): 7,000-10,000 BTU
- Large Room (over 300 sq ft): 10,000 BTU and above
These are just estimates, and the actual BTU needs may vary depending on factors like insulation, window size, sunlight exposure, and the number of occupants. Consult manufacturer guidelines or use online BTU calculators for more precise estimates.
Setting Up Your Portable Air Conditioner
Proper setup is essential for optimal performance and safety.
- Find a suitable ventilation point: Ensure the exhaust hose can reach a window, door, or other suitable opening that allows for proper ventilation.
- Seal the gap: Use the provided window kit or create a seal around the exhaust hose to prevent hot air from recirculating into the room. This is crucial for effective cooling.
- Level the unit: Ensure the unit is level to prevent vibrations and noise.
- Fill the water reservoir (if applicable): Some units require filling a water reservoir, particularly evaporative coolers. Always follow the manufacturer's instructions regarding water level.
- Plug it in: Plug the unit into a dedicated circuit to avoid overloading the electrical system.
Maintenance and Troubleshooting
Regular maintenance extends the life of your portable AC unit and ensures optimal performance.
- Clean the filters regularly: Dirty filters restrict airflow and reduce efficiency. Clean or replace filters as recommended by the manufacturer (usually every 2-4 weeks).
- Clean the condenser coils: The condenser coils release heat and can become dusty, reducing efficiency. Clean them with a coil cleaning brush or vacuum cleaner.
- Empty the condensate tank (if applicable): Some units collect condensation, which needs to be emptied periodically.
- Check the exhaust hose: Make sure the hose is not kinked or blocked, which can hinder the cooling process.
Common Issues and Solutions:
- Unit is not cooling effectively: Check the filters, condenser coils, and exhaust hose. Ensure proper ventilation. Check the BTU rating to make sure it's appropriate for the room size.
- Unit is leaking water: This could be due to a clogged drain or a faulty seal. Check the water level and inspect the unit for leaks.
- Unit is making unusual noises: This could indicate a mechanical issue. Check for loose parts and consult the manufacturer’s instructions or contact customer support.
- Unit is not turning on: Check the power cord, circuit breaker, and outlet.
Frequently Asked Questions (FAQ)
-
Q: How much does a portable AC unit cost? A: Prices vary greatly depending on the features, BTU rating, and brand. You can find basic models for under $200, while high-end units can cost over $500.
-
Q: Are portable AC units energy-efficient? A: Compared to window units, they are generally less energy-efficient. However, advancements in technology are improving their efficiency. Choose models with high EER/SEER ratings to minimize energy consumption.
-
Q: How much electricity do they use? A: Electricity consumption depends on the BTU rating and usage time. Check the unit's specifications for the power consumption (usually in watts).
-
Q: Can I use a portable AC in a tent or RV? A: Portable AC units designed for small spaces might work, but ensure adequate ventilation and consider the power source availability.
-
Q: Are portable AC units noisy? A: Some units are quieter than others. Check the decibel rating before purchasing.
